PREDICTED LINE-UPS | Inter v Benfica

The Champions League restarts this week and today, Inter will play Benfica.

Inter drew their first game in a disappointing outing against Real Sociedad. They were outplayed in Spain and Nicolo Barella had a red card overturned, but they still couldn’t take advantage. 

Benfica were thoroughly outplayed in their fixture against Salzburg and lost 2-0. They conceded an XG of 3.4 and it was a worrying display.

With Inter playing at home tomorrow, they will be clear favourites and expected to win. Their last league game was a convincing 4-0 win over Salernitana and Lautaro Martinez bagged all four goals.

The strike partnership between him and Marcus Thuram is still in its early stages, but a game like this could be great to build some confidence and chemistry.  

Group D is not one of the more muscular groups and after reaching the final last season, Inter are expected to top it comfortably. 

Benfica have made a near perfect start to the league with six wins from seven, but the Champions League is a level above and they will need to be at their best to get anything tomorrow.

Here are the predicted starting line-ups for the match:

Inter (3-5-2): Sommer; Pavard, De Vrij, Bastoni; Dumfries, Barella, Calhanoglu, Mkhitaryan, Dimarco; Martinez, Thuram

Benfica (4-2-3-1): Trubin; Bah, Otamendi, Morato, Aursnes; Kokcu, Neves; Di Maria, Neres, Silva; Musa
